A 21-year-old Bolivar man suffered minor injuries after a single-vehicle crash on HWY 245 northwest of Pittsburg, according to a preliminary report from the Missouri State Highway Patrol.

The crash occurred at 10:30 p.m. on July 3, 2026, about 3.5 miles northwest of Pittsburg, the patrol reported. A 2019 Ford Fusion was traveling eastbound at the time of the incident, according to the report.

The driver sustained minor injuries and was transported for medical treatment, the Missouri State Highway Patrol said. No other vehicles were involved in the crash, and no fatalities were reported.

The incident is being investigated by Missouri State Highway Patrol Troop D. The crash has been logged under report number 260278774.

Legal context
Injury statute of limitations
5 years (From date of accident (RSMo 516.120) - one of the longest injury windows in the US.)
Wrongful death statute of limitations
3 years (From date of death (RSMo 537.100).)
Fault rule
Missouri uses pure comparative fault: recovery is reduced by your percentage of fault but not barred.
Citations
RSMo 516.120 (SoL); RSMo 537.100 (wrongful death); pure comparative per Gustafson v. Benda
